A polymer contains 50 molecules with molecular mass 5000, 100 molecules with molecular mass 10,000 and 50 molecules with molecular mass 15,000.Calculate number average molecular mass ?

A

5000

B

75000

C

10000

D

20000

Text Solution

Verified by Experts

The correct Answer is:
C

`:'` Number average molecular mass `(M bar(n))`
`(N_(1)M_(1)+N_(2)M_(2)+N_(3)M_(3))/(N_(1)+N_(2)N_(3))`
where `N_(1), N_(2)` and `N_(3)` are number of molecules and `M_(1), M_(2)` and `M_(3)` are respectively their molecular masses.
Given, `N_(1)=50` and `M_(1)=5000`
`N_(2)=100` and `M_(2)=10,000`
`N_(3)=50` and `M_(3)=15,000`
Thus, `M bar(n)=(N_(1)M_(1)+N_(2)M_(2)+N_(3)M_(3))/(N_(1)+N_(2)+N_(3))`
`=((50xx5000)+(100xx10,000)+(50xx15000))/(50+100+50)`
`=((25,0000)+(1,000,000)+(75,00,00))/200`
`M bar(n)=10,000`
Hence, option (c) is the correct answer.
